A journalist may be a writer, editor, photographer, broadcaster, and a producer. The forcus is on editorial article or paper. Since editorial is a news article for a newspaper or magazine expresses the opinion of the editor or writer, an editorial maybe structured in essay or thesis style. The characteristics of timeliness, proximity, prominence, conflict, impact, human interest, and novelty are the guide in deciding what information is newsworthy and how to present it.

The word or idea, advertorial, goes back to 1946 in Webster dictionary and in 1961 in Webster Third International dictionary. In 1970, Mobile Oil actually put the idea in practice when they decided to change their marketing strategy. Advertorial is a paid advertisement like informercial in an editorial content. Although an advertorial has editorial content, it is also a press release which has factual basis on concerned issue, product, or service.
Advertorial appears to be an objective opinion by the person who has endorsed your product or service. In reality, advertorial is non-objective because an ad has no negative expression. An advertorial maybe recognized by it font and the kind of paper that it appears on. This editorial type of advertisement seem to grasp the consumers attention while they make an educated decision on the promoted product or service from given information in the ad. An advertorial may be in newspaper, magazine, on television, radio, internet, and other type of media.
